Yes you can set your homepage as a blog if you need. You can do this from the Settings > Reading page in your WP admin. Just create a page with the Blog template and add that as your homepage.

If you don’t add any widgets to the home widget areas then the blog will show by default….but to avoid the homepage template from showing up by mistake (if you add any content inside of the widgets) you can set the blog page as the homepage as mentioned above.
